El Cid! (More on Mccain's Liberation of Spain)

We wanted to give you an update on the post below where we described Sen. McCain's latest gaffe in which he seemed to suggest that he might not be willing to meet with Spanish Prime Minster Zapatero because he is among those world leaders who want to harm America.

The story is already getting picked up pretty quickly in the Spanish press. And the way it's being interpreted in the Spanish press is that McCain got confused about the fact that Spain is a country in Europe, rather than a rogue state in Latin America.

Our review of the audio suggests the same conclusion. In the interview, McCain is asked about Hugo Chavez, the situation in Bolivia and then about Raul Castro. He responds to each of these with expected answers about standing up to America's enemies, etc. Then the interviewer switches gears and asks about Zapatero, the Spanish Prime Minister. And McCain replies -- very loose translation -- that he'll establish close relations with our friends and stand out to those who want to do us harm. The interviewer has a double take and seems to think McCain might be confused. So she asks it again. But McCain sticks to the same evasive answer.

This is obviously a story that's difficult to get a handle on because of multiple layers of translation and retranslation. 9. I listened to the radio interview
I listened to the radio interview and, while it's difficult to hear some of McSame's words over the voice of the translator, the overall excellent quality of the translation makes it apparent that it did accurately reflect what he was saying in English. He was so geared into his talking points and focused on the questions on Latin America that either he didn't hear (or worse, didn't KNOW) that Zapatero is from Spain, not Latin America. His answer was that he wouldn't answer whether he would invite Zapatero to the White House, falling back on his tired talking point of "we will meet with our friends and not with our enemies", blah blah blah.
